uPVC windows can have problems opening or locking. This usually happens when the locking mechanism has become stiff or jammed. If this is the case, an easy fix is to apply graphite powder or machine oil to lubricate the handle and lock mechanism. This will enable the mechanism to be freed up and allow the window or door to operate normal again.

Another issue that can be found with uPVC windows is that the hinges become stiff or stuck. This issue is typically caused by dust and grit building up on the hinges with time. Lubricating the hinges using grease or oil is the solution. If you use the wrong grease, however, could lead to damage and may make the hinges unusable.

Leaded glass cracks may be caused by thermal expansion and contraction, building movement or just normal wear and tear. The cracks may grow and cause more problems over time. To avoid further damage and enlargement, a crack that is located across the face of stained-glass panels or their face should be repaired as quickly as is possible. In the past, this was accomplished by splicing the "Dutchman's" lead flange on top of the crack. This was not a good method of repair and now there are more effective methods to repair these types cracks.

Stained glass restoration is a specific art that can take a variety of forms. It could be as simple as fixing cracks, or as difficult as restoring an entire stained glass window or door panel to its original form. In general, the cost of a complete restoration is much higher than a simple repair. The project involves cleaning and getting rid of damaged glass, securing lead cames, sealing the cement and re-tying it and replacing stained glass pieces that are missing.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ping keeps air and water from coming into homes through gaps around windows and doors. It is an important aspect of home maintenance that can save you money on costs for energy and Window Repairs Near Me repairs that are costly. It also makes homes more comfortable. The materials used to make the seal may degrade over time, Window Repairs Near Me as a result of wear and tears. It is crucial to replace these materials from time to time.

You can determine if your weather stripping has been damaged by noticing a spot that is wet after washing your windows, a whistling noise when driving, or a draft that you feel in front of the door that is closed. These are all good indicators to locate a Tasker near me who can repair your weatherstripping.

Taskers can employ a variety of weatherstripping materials to seal your windows and doors. Foam tapes are composed of open-cell or closed cell foam. They are available in various sizes, thicknesses, and widths. They are simple to install and can be easily cut using scissors. Felt strips are inexpensive and last for at least a year. You can cut them to size with scissors, and attach them to the frame of your door, hinge side, or sliding window using glue, staples or tacks. Vinyl or metal V strips are a little more difficult to install, but can be nailed along the window jamb.
